The Importance of Eco-Friendly Cooling Units in Historic Preservation

Historic preservation is a crucial endeavor that aims to safeguard our cultural heritage and maintain the architectural integrity of significant structures from the past. From iconic landmarks to neighborhood gems, these historic buildings provide a glimpse into our history and shape the character of our cities. However, preserving these buildings comes with its fair share of challenges, including the need to maintain a comfortable indoor environment while minimizing the impact on the environment. This is where eco-friendly cooling units play a vital role.

The Benefits of Custom Cooling Solutions

Historic buildings often present unique challenges when it comes to cooling. Their architectural features, such as thick walls and limited insulation, can make it difficult to maintain a comfortable indoor environment without compromising the integrity of the structure. This is where custom cooling solutions shine.

Eco-friendly cooling units can be tailored to the specific needs of historic buildings, taking into account factors such as size, layout, and historical significance. Precision cooling systems can be installed discreetly, ensuring minimal impact on the building's aesthetics while delivering optimal cooling performance. By providing a customized approach to cooling, these units help preserve the architectural integrity of historic structures while creating a comfortable environment for occupants and visitors.

The Environmental Benefits of Green Cooling Technology

Adopting eco-friendly cooling units in historic preservation projects offers numerous environmental benefits. By reducing energy consumption and carbon emissions, these units contribute to the fight against climate change. Sustainable cooling solutions also minimize the need for refrigerants that deplete the ozone layer and contribute to global warming.

Furthermore, by prioritizing energy-efficiency and environmental responsibility, the preservation community sets an example for other industries. By showcasing the potential of green cooling technology, historic preservation can inspire wider adoption of sustainable practices in other sectors, leading to a more environmentally conscious society as a whole.
